Footnotes

1. The current coverage amount will be reset to 100% of the coverage amount if the UCC policy is in force 12 months after the last critical illness claim.

2. Unlimited claims apply to major stage of critical illnesses. Only one claim is payable for each stage of a critical illness. The total amounts payable for all stages of a critical illness shall not exceed 100% of the coverage amount. Maximum claim limit of 500% of coverage amount applies to early and intermediate stage of critical illnesses.

3. Applicable for early and intermediate stage critical illnesses covered by UCC policy. The total amounts payable for the early and intermediate stage of the same critical illness shall not exceed S$350,000 per life combined across all the UCC policies covering the same insured.

4. The UCC policy will terminate after the death benefit or accidental death benefit is paid out.

5. Two-year waiting period applies. We will only admit a claim for Ultimate Relapse Critical Illness Condition if we have previously paid 100% of the coverage amount under the Critical Illness Benefit for any stage of the same critical illness.

6. This benefit is payable once and terminates thereafter.
